| Name |
thermospermine synthase;
TSPMS;
ACL5;
SAC51
|
| Class |
Transferases;
Transferring alkyl or aryl groups, other than methyl groups;
Transferring alkyl or aryl groups, other than methyl groups (only sub-subclass identified to date)
 |
| Sysname |
S-adenosylmethioninamine:spermidine 3-aminopropyltransferase (thermospermine synthesizing)
|
| Reaction(IUBMB) |
S-adenosylmethioninamine + spermidine = S-methyl-5'-thioadenosine + thermospermine + H+ [RN: R09531]
|
| Reaction(KEGG) |
|
| Substrate |
S-adenosylmethioninamine [CPD: C01137];
spermidine [CPD: C00315]
|
| Product |
|
| Comment |
This enzyme is required for correct xylem specification through regulation of the lifetime of the xylem elements [3].
